#4a2863 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a2863 is composed of 29% red, 15.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.3%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 274.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 27.3%. #4a2863 color hex could be obtained by blending #9450c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#4a2863 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#4a2863 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a2863 has RGB values of R:74, G:40,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 4860003.

Shades and Tints of #4a2863
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a2863
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464348 is the less saturated color, while #500388 is the most saturated one.
